REPORT
The SPOGOMI Sri Lanka Qualifier was successfully held on 2nd August 2025 in the scenic coastal city of Mount Lavinia. A total of 25 teams, selected from regional qualifiers held across all provinces since April, competed in this national final. Despite slightly overcast skies, the weather was ideal for this unique competition where teams collect and sort litter to earn points. Over 150 participants and spectators attended the event, including special invitees and guests. The Chief Guest was His Excellency Akio Isomata, Ambassador of Japan to Sri Lanka, joined by his wife. The competition saw an impressive 553.6 kg of waste collected by all teams combined. Team ECO Active emerged as the national winner, earning over 8,000 points and securing their place to represent Sri Lanka at the SPOGOMI World Cup. The event was fully organized by dedicated volunteers of the Zero Plastic Movement, with the valuable support of JICA volunteers from Japan.

COMMENT
We are Team Plastic Hunters from the Central Province, Kandy District, Sri Lanka, representing the University of Peradeniya, Faculty of Arts. Our team members — A.L. Nisan Madhusanka, J. Dilukshan, and B. Vithursigan — are passionate undergraduates dedicated to promoting environmental sustainability. We proudly won the SPOGOMI Sri Lanka National Qualifiers, organized by Zero Plastic Movement, earning the honour to represent Sri Lanka at the SPOGOMI World Cup 2025, hosted by the Nippon Foundation in Japan. Our mission is to create a cleaner, greener world by taking action against plastic pollution and inspiring communities to join the global effort for a sustainable planet.
